Starks Out For Season

By Chris

The University at Buffalo’s chances of repeating as Mid-American Conference champions has taken a sudden turn for the worse.
Senior running back and Niagara Falls native James Starks, the school’s all-time leading rusher, has suffered a labral tear in his shoulder that will require surgery. The injury will cause him to miss the entire 2009 season.
